I downloaded it and it came out with a PHP File, what program do I need to use to open it? I tried notepad and it came out some texts.

DonGiovanni

upload to your website and it will automatically start installation trough couple steps. But you need to have php and mysql ;)

You need to buy webhosting. You have great discussion about hostings HERE

Also you can assign to free hosting in my signature link. It's also good. When you get hosting account. You need to use ftp to upload this forum folder to your web space and just need to run installation
